QEMU Multiple Local Vulnerabilities
QEMU is prone to multiple locally exploitable buffer-overflow and denial-of-service vulnerabilities. The buffer-overflow issues occur because the software fails to properly check boundaries of user-supplied input when copying it to insufficiently sized memory buffers. The denial-of-service issues stem from design errors. Attackers may be able to exploit these issues to escalate privileges, execute arbitrary code, or trigger denial-of-service conditions in the context of the affected applications. |
